exhibitions


·      New York (1988):  The Anatolian Women's Traditional Handmade Apparel, Jewelry, Socks and Gloves Exhibit within the scope of the Süleyman the Magnificent Exhibition at the Bloomingdales Chain Stores.

·      Chicago (1988): Card-weaving Exhibition and Demonstration at the Art Institute

·      Hannover (1990): The Anatolian Women's Headdresses and Jewelry Exhibition

·      Ottawa (1994): The Anatolian Bridal Room Exhibit at the Tulip Festival

·      Beijing (1995): Anatolian Women and Traces of the Mother Goddess Culture in Weaving Exhibition and Conference (within the scope of the World Women's Conference)

·      New York (1999): The Anatolian Motifs from Çatalhöyük to the Present Exhibition (at the Turkish House Art Gallery at the United Nations Plaza)

·      Ottawa (2002): International Floral Design Apparel Competition within the Scope of the Tulip Festival
